It therefore wouldn\u2019t make sense for Coinbase to list a gang of assets that might provoke regulators (in the United States, \u201cnonaccredited\u201d investors are barred from early project investment).<\/p>\n<p>While the Securities and Exchange Commission is <a target=\"_blank\" href=\"https:\/\/cointelegraph.com\/news\/sec-expected-to-head-u-s-regulation-of-stablecoins\" rel=\"noopener\">treating<\/a> stablecoins as securities, Coinbase\u2019s listing parade has continued almost weekly. It is very likely that there are assets added to Coinbase\u2019s trade pairs that the SEC would deem securities. However, the barriers that currently exist in the name of \u201cinvestor protection\u201d may finally be coming down. Coinbase\u2019s aggressive listing activity squares with the economic freedom, strong property rights, and core values that it supports, and may even hint at undisclosed policy being discussed privately.<\/p>\n<p>As Melissa Strait, chief compliance officer at Coinbase, <a target=\"_blank\" href=\"https:\/\/blog.coinbase.com\/how-coinbase-is-making-compliance-a-driver-of-innovation-b33cfec84bb2\" rel=\"noopener nofollow\">pointed<\/a> out:<\/p>\n<blockquote><p>\u201cWe\u2019ve always believed that for crypto to gain the legitimacy needed for mainstream adoption, compliance can\u2019t be an afterthought \u2014 it has to be core to the way we operate.\u201d<\/p><\/blockquote>\n<p>She also added: \u201cWe strongly believe that in order for cryptocurrency to gain widespread acceptance, we must have a constructive relationship with the regulators and agencies that have been charged with oversight of the crypto ecosystem.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>Nearly all the assets listed this year are <a target=\"_blank\" href=\"https:\/\/cointelegraph.com\/explained\/erc-20-tokens-explained\" rel=\"noopener\">ERC-20 tokens<\/a> on the Ethereum network. Why? Because they would be deemed \u201csufficiently decentralized.\u201d This phrase is taken from a speech that William Hinman (former director of the SEC\u2019s Division of Corporation Finance) <a target=\"_blank\" href=\"https:\/\/cointelegraph.com\/news\/did-the-sec-chairman-confirm-ethereum-isnt-a-security-not-quite-but-its-optimistic\" rel=\"noopener\">made<\/a> in June 2018. So long as an asset is as decentralized as Etherum was on the day of that speech, it is informally and tentatively not considered a security. After all, a Coinbase listing is like making it to the big leagues. <\/p>\n<h2>What now?<\/h2>\n<p>Coinbase listed 16 DeFi projects in 2021. It doesn\u2019t come at a shock that decentralized finance takes the top spot. First-layer projects came in second place with 12 \u2014 again not really a surprise, as everyone wants to be the next Ethereum. In third place were eight decentralized exchange tokens, while tied in fourth place were stablecoins and NFT gaming, each with seven projects. Taking fifth place were layer-two Ethereum projects.<\/p>\n<p>Coinbase really stepped on the gas this year. It can mean any number of things depending on who you ask.
